The aim of this research was to investigate the behavior of cold recycled materials in bitumen emulsion. Firstly a rheological analysis was conducted to establish the effects of rejuvenant on reclaimed pavement; then a mix design procedure for recycled materials was calibrated. Finally the influence of temperature of compaction was considered. The results obtained showed that: the proposed mix design procedure allows to increase the role of components on the behavior of the mixture; the influence of rejuvenant is related to the temperature and condition of the bitumen; the effects of the increase of temperature are strictly dependent on the percentage of bitumen.
► The effects of rejuvenant on bituminous mastics decrease on temperature.
► A mix design procedure for recycled materials with separated phases is proposed.
► The slotted mold pushes out water during compaction simulating onsite condition.
► The effect of temperature on compaction decreases on emulsion content.
